Comprehending the Link Between Railroad Work and Cancer
Railroad workers face numerous health risks due to their workplace. The main harmful materials in this market include:
Asbestos: Commonly used for insulation and fireproofing.Diesel Exhaust: Emitted from engines and other heavy machinery.Benzene: Often found in products utilized for cleaning and devices maintenance.Toluene and Xylene: Solvents that can be harmful with repetitive exposure.
The exposure to these toxic substances can increase the danger of numerous kinds of cancer, consisting of:
Lung cancerMesotheliomaBladder cancerLeukemiaLaryngeal cancer
Comprehending the underlying health dangers can help those impacted by these illness acknowledge their right to seek financial payment through settlement claims.
Elements Influencing Railroad Cancer Settlement Amounts
Settlement amounts can differ considerably based on a number of aspects. Here are some key factors to consider:

Type of Cancer: Different cancers have varying links to railroad work and can affect settlement amounts. For instance:
Mesothelioma cases usually command greater settlements due to the aggressive nature of the disease and the developed links to asbestos.Lung cancer can likewise lead to significant settlements, especially if tied to prolonged direct exposure to diesel exhaust.
Severity of Illness: The phase of the cancer at medical diagnosis and general diagnosis can affect the settlement amount.

Length of Employment: Longer direct exposure to harmful substances may strengthen a claim, as it could show disregard from the company in providing safe working conditions.

Paperwork: A well-documented case with strong medical evidence and proof of exposure can result in greater settlements.

Legal Representation: Experienced lawyers concentrating on railroad cancer claims can work out better settlements due to their understanding of the complexities of the law.

State Laws: Different states have differing statutes concerning work environment injury and toxic tort claims. This can affect both the probability of a successful claim and the possible amount obtained.

Here are steps that railroad workers or their families should take when pursuing a cancer settlement:

Consultation with Legal Experts: Seek an experienced attorney acquainted with FELA (Federal Employers Liability Act) or other appropriate statutes.

Gather Documentation:
Medical recordsWork historyProof of exposure to hazardous products
Work out with Employers or Insurers: Settlement negotiations may occur with the railroad business or liability insurance providers.

Submit a Claim: If settlements are not successful, it may be essential to file a formal claim or suit.

Prepare for Court: Although lots of cases settle out of court, being gotten ready for a trial may influence settlements.
